Download Full Dataset (.xlsx)Latest updates. In Japan, seasonally-adjusted electricity generation from nuclear plants was 8.17 TWh in November 2025, compared to 6.90 in October 2025. This represents an increase of 18.41 percent.
Sample. The monthly series shown in the graph has 83 records overall. The series covers the time span going from January 2019 to November 2025.
History. Here's a glimpse of a few summary statistics computed on the whole sample: generation reached its minimum of 1.31 TWh in November 2020; it reached its highest level of 9.17 in March 2025; it had a mean of 5.67.
